The Government updates the regulatory framework for the fisheries dector and sea-related activities

19th September 2025 by Agencies

The new regulation also introduces changes to three other decrees in order to reduce administrative burdens and provide greater support for both sustainable fisheries management and marine-related economic activities.

The Ministry of Agriculture, Fisheries, and Natural Environment has released for public consultation the draft decree regulating fishermen’s guilds and their federations in the Balearic Islands. The text also amends Decrees 55/2020 (December 19th), 14/2014 (March 14th), and 26/2025 (July 4th). In this regard, the Director General of Fisheries, Antoni M. Grau, noted that fishermen’s guilds “are public law institutions with centuries of history that safeguard the interests of the sector and act as intermediaries with the Administration.” Grau highlighted that “they are an essential link between fishermen and the various administrations. That is why the Government fully recognizes their key role within the sector and will continue working to ensure they can carry out their duties under the best possible conditions.”

Decree 61/1995 established a specific regulatory framework for the first time, but over time, technological and administrative changes have made it outdated. “Now, the new text aims to address the current and future needs of the sector, ensuring principles of legality, equality, transparency, and internal democracy, while providing the guilds with a solid legal framework to face the challenges of modern fisheries,” emphasized Director General Antoni M. Grau.

There are a total of sixteen fishermen’s guilds in the Balearic Islands, grouped under a federation (Balearic Federation of Fishermen’s Guilds), which carry out tasks related to cohesion, training, social functions, and collaboration in the marketing of catches.

The draft decree also includes amendments to three other decrees. Regarding professional and scientific diving, Decree 55/2020 has been updated to simplify procedures, eliminate unnecessary steps, and facilitate business and scientific research activities. For recreational diving, Decree 14/2014 has been adapted to align with Royal Decree 550/2020 and support the economic activity of dive centers. Additionally, Decree 26/2025 incorporates a specific correction in Annex 3 concerning the Marine Reserve of the Illes del Ponent (El Toro, Les Malgrats, and El Sec) to facilitate tourist diving activities.

In short, with these amendments, the Government aims to modernize the regulatory framework for the fisheries and diving sectors, reduce administrative burdens, and provide greater support for both sustainable fisheries management and sea-related economic activities.
